James H. Schiff was recently named Director of Finance at Bishop’s Lodge Ranch Resort & Spa, Santa Fe, N.M. A 25-year veteran of the hospitality industry and Albuquerque native, Schiff has held the designation of Certified Hospitality Accounting Executive since 1991. He attended the University of New Mexico and is a Graduate of San Diego State University. |
The Spa of Colonial Williamsburg, along with its management firm, WTS International, Inc., has selected Kate Mearns as Director of the Virginia property. Mearns is the current chairman of the International SPA Association and represents the spa industry in numerous speaking engagements, media events and partnership alliances worldwide. |
Philadelphia Country Club, Gladwyne, Pa., has hired Nathan A. Wakefield, CSA, as its new Executive Chef. Wakefield was most recently Executive Chef with the Minneapolis Club, ranked the best city club in Minnesota and the seventh-best city club in the U. S. |

Veteran contractor Rich Abbott has been named President of the newly opened Southeast Division of Frontier Golf, a Jones Mill, Pa.-based course construction company. Prior to joining Frontier, Abbott handled dozens of renovation projects across the Southeast, including Lexington (N.C.) Golf Club, which earned runner-up honors in Golf Inc. magazine's Renovation of the Year competition in 2004. |
E-Z-GO, a leading manufacturer of golf cars and utility vehicles, has promoted Michael Parkhurst to the position of Vice President, Golf Channel and Branch Operations. Formerly the company’s Director of Golf Sales in the U.S., Parkhurst will assume responsibility for all domestic golf sales. |
Amy Spittle, formerly Sales and Marketing Director for The Golf Resort at Indian Wells, has been named a Regional Director of Sales and Marketing for KemperSports.
